What are some common art teacher quotes?
Many art teachers impart timeless wisdom, often adapted and shared among the art education community. While pinpointing the exact origin of every quote is challenging, common themes emerge. These include the importance of embracing mistakes ("Embrace the happy accidents!"), the power of observation ("Look closely, really look."), and the value of persistence ("Keep trying; it's a process."). These aren't just teaching techniques; they are life lessons in resilience, attention to detail, and the acceptance of imperfection.

What are some of the most impactful quotes from art teachers?
While attributing specific quotes to specific teachers is often difficult, the spirit of these impactful sayings resonates with many:
- "There are no mistakes, only opportunities." This quote embodies the philosophy of embracing imperfection and viewing errors as stepping stones to innovation. It encourages experimentation without the fear of failure.
- "Don't be afraid to make a mess." This quote promotes risk-taking and the acceptance of the process. Creative breakthroughs often involve a certain level of chaos and experimentation.
- "Art is about the journey, not just the destination." This encourages appreciating the process of creation, the learning, the experimentation, and the growth involved in the artistic journey. It's about the experience itself.
- "Let your imagination run wild." This quote emphasizes the importance of uninhibited creativity and trusting one's intuition. It encourages a playful and fearless approach to art-making.
- "Find your voice." This transcends artistic expression, encouraging individuals to develop their unique perspectives and styles, not only in art but in all aspects of life.
